WebbTypes of intermolecular forces: Dipole-dipole force: Attraction between two polar molecules. Hydrogen bonding: Attraction between two molecules containing one of the very polar bonds of O-H, N-H, and F-H. London dispersion force: Attraction between two non-polar molecules due to momentary and induced dipoles.
